
Volleyball Leaves Monroe with Second Conference Win
9/28/2024 5:02:00 PM | Women's Volleyball
MONROE, La. — Southern Miss volleyball earned their second 3-0 sweep over ULM on Saturday afternoon in Monroe.
Southern Miss came out swinging in the opening set. With kills from Aysu Dalogullari, the Golden Eagles took the lead early and went up 5-2. ULM tied the set three times, but Southern Miss pulled away to win the set 25–20. Dalogullari contributed aces to the set, while Sunni Sheppard made efficient digs to complement blocks from Torrey Tkach.
With eleven ties in set two, it held a more competitive atmosphere from the crown and both teams. ULM was fighting back, and the Warhawks led 17–16 in the last moments of play. However, Sadie McAda's consecutive kills gave Southern Miss the momentum and they went on to win the set 25–22.
Southern Miss hit the ground running to an early 11-2 lead in the third set. In the set, McAda and Madison Baldridge combined for six kills, and Tkach chipped in with four blocks. With two service aces added from Sunni Sheppard, Southern Miss won 25–18 to end the match and close the series.
The Golden Eagles improve to 6-8 (2-0 Sun Belt) while the Warhawks fall to 4-10 (0-2 Sun Belt).
Southern Miss returns home after a four-week travel schedule to play at home on October 3-4 against Arkansas State. Friday's game will be themed for Block Out Cancer/Pink Out to honor those who have been affected by breast cancer.
